DNHN - (CT) - Information from the Can Tho City Delegation visiting and working in France, led by comrade Tran Viet Truong, Chairman of the People's Committee of Can Tho City (September 25). working at the Vietnamese Embassy in France and the AIMF
Comrade Tran Viet Truong, who worked at the Vietnamese Embassy in France, thanked the Embassy for assisting the Delegation in connecting with partners and organising the Delegation's working programme in France. Can Tho has consistently promoted international affairs, contributing to the city's socioeconomic growth. Specifically, the city directs and disseminates a large number of documents and implementation plans pertaining to cultural diplomacy, economic diplomacy, the work of Vietnamese people abroad, and information connection... Specifically, the city is always proactive. Contact and consult with the Ministry of Foreign Affairs on a regular basis in order to reach a consensus on solutions to diplomatic issues.
This working group also includes a number of companies that wish to expand trade and cooperation with French companies. The business trip is anticipated to strengthen friendly cooperation with Nice City (which signed an MOU with Can Tho City in 2011), particularly in the fields of health, education, tourism, and... To ensure Cooperative activities with the City of Nice and other French partners, Can Tho hopes that the Vietnamese Embassy in France will regularly provide the city with information and French cooperation needs so that the city can swiftly develop an effective coordination plan.
Mr. Dinh Toan Thang, the Vietnamese Ambassador to France, stated that Can Tho City's organisation of a trade and investment promotion delegation reconnected it with its sister city, Nice City, in conjunction with the commemoration of Vietnam and France's 50th anniversary. It is essential to establish diplomatic relations and a 10-year Strategic Partnership. We believe that the delegation's trip will create new opportunities for Can Tho to find a suitable French partner, as well as strengthen the already cordial cooperation between Nice and Can Tho. In addition, a number of French localities, including Can Tho - a region where French partners wish to cooperate and invest in the implementation of response solutions - are keen on establishing investment cooperation in Vietnam. Responding to climate change and fostering cultural traditions... The Vietnamese Ambassador to France is prepared to facilitate Can Tho and French partners communication. Concurrently, Can Tho will be regarded as one of the most important locales in the promotional efforts of the Vietnamese Embassy in France.
In a meeting with AIMF representatives, comrade Tran Viet Truong announced that the city of Can Tho had joined AIMF in 2018, in accordance with AIMF's principles and activities aimed at achieving good goals and promoting sustainable and modern development. Civilised, modern, and secure for humanity. In recent years, numerous AIMF grants have helped Can Tho achieve its sustainable development objectives. Can Tho has actively contacted and coordinated with AIMF, particularly AIMF coordinators in Vietnam and Phnom Penh (Cambodia), to participate in programmes and projects implemented by AIMF. This demonstrates Can Tho's responsibility and high determination to integrate into the Francophone community and Southeast Asia region.
Mr. Pierre Baillet, the AIMF's permanent secretary, stated that Can Tho is one of the Association's most important members. Although Can Tho was only a member of the association for a short time, it contributed positively to its movements and activities. In the future, it is hoped that Can Tho will strengthen the connection between Association members in order to share results and experiences in implementing activities of interest to the Association, such as change response experience. Improve the skills, life experience, and coping abilities of vulnerable forces (women and children) confronting the effects of urbanisation and climate change... Simultaneously, we will continue to link Can Tho with other locations in the Association that share similarities with Can Tho, so that all parties can share and develop together...
